With applying agile methodologies comes changes in many aspects of delivering software. And with any change will come a time when something fails. How to keep everyone calm? How to provide practical solutions to prevent people from reverting back to non-agile practices at the first roadblock? Through examples gathered from personal experience and the community, we’ll explore ways to prevent the boat from sinking at the first spilled glass of water.

Sebastien has been a passionate code monkey since his early teens, and has experienced agile first hand, as a developer and as a scrum master, for several years. He’s the director of London-based Caffeine IT, a consulting / contracting company, and writes open-source software in his spare time.
